Former Fenwick teacher/coach Kulevich to be honored in Marblehead
MARBLEHEAD — The Marblehead School Committee voted unanimously Thursday in favor of naming the athletic complex at Marblehead High after Alex Kulevich. Kulevich, 89, arrived at Marblehead High in 1970 as a history teacher and the head football coach.
